How they compare
Tonga currently reports 89.2% against 83.6% in Armenia, a difference of 5.6%.
That makes Tonga's figure about 1.1 times Armenia's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 11 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Armenia ahead.
Armenia ranks 8th and Tonga ranks 5th of 144 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Armenia averaged higher in 5 and Tonga in 1.
